Drunken bar patron damages employee car

May 26, 2022 By Times-Herald Newspapers Leave a Comment

By SUE SUCHYTA

Sunday Times Newspapers

RIVERVIEW — An employee at Slip Mahoney’s Bar and Grill called police officers the night of May 17 when a drunken customer, a 47-year-old Southgate woman, crashed into an employee’s vehicle in the parking lot. 

The customer causing the damage was unsteady on her feet, and had difficulty focusing. She admitted to having had several alcoholic drinks at the bar. 

She failed multiple standard field sobriety tests. A preliminary breath test was administered, and the woman had a blood alcohol content of 0.222, almost three times the 0.08 limit for legally drunk in Michigan. 

She was arrested for operating while intoxicated, her vehicle was impounded and towed, and she was booked and held.
